随着区块链技术的飞速发展,加密货币的普及也日益增强,区块链钱包的应用越来越广泛。它不仅是用户存储和管理...
比特币作为一种数字货币,以其去中心化和高安全性著称。然而,用户在进行比特币交易时,常常会遇到一个关键概念:钱包签名。很多用户可能会好奇,究竟比特币的钱包签名在哪里?它是如何在保障交易安全中发挥作用的?本文将深入探讨比特币钱包签名的相关知识,引导读者理解其工作原理和重要性。
比特币钱包是用户管理比特币资产的重要工具。它不仅仅是存储比特币的地方,更是用户与区块链交互的窗口。钱包的功能可以分为生成和管理比特币地址、接收和发送比特币、查看交易记录以及生成交易签名等。
比特币钱包通常分为热钱包和冷钱包两种类型。热钱包是连接到互联网的,例如通过手机应用和在线钱包;而冷钱包离线储存,如硬件钱包或纸钱包。虽然热钱包使用方便,但相对来说安全性较低;而冷钱包则因为离线存储,相对安全,但不如热钱包便捷。
在比特币交易中,钱包签名是一种数字签名,目的是验证交易的合法性。这种签名是通过使用私钥进行加密而生成的,保证只有拥有对应私钥的用户才能对交易进行签名,从而确保交易的真实性和不可篡改性。
在比特币网络中,每一笔交易都需要进行签名。用户的比特币钱包会自动生成这种签名,用户只需确认交易并授权。交易签名不仅涵盖了交易的基本信息,还包含了一定的随机因素,确保即使两次相同的交易生成的签名也会不同。
要理解比特币钱包签名的“位置”,我们需要明确其生成过程。签名并不是直接可见的,而是通过交易的创建过程生成的。用户在发起交易时,钱包应用会自动根据该交易的内容和用户的私钥生成签名。这一过程通常是在钱包软件的后台进行,用户不需要手动操作。
用户可以在与其交易的比特币区块链浏览器中查看交易信息,包括交易的输入输出、时间戳、交易哈希以及签名等数据。然而,签名本身是加密的,普通用户通常无法直接解读。对于每个交易,都会有一个或多个签名与之关联,这些签名确保了交易的合法性。
比特币交易的安全性依赖于多种机制,而钱包签名则是其核心之一。通过签名,钱包不仅可以确认发起交易的用户确实拥有相应的比特币,还能通过签名验证交易是否在传输过程中未被篡改。
如果没有签名,任何人都可以轻松伪造交易,侵占他人比特币资产。因此,签名的存在极大增强了比特币系统的安全性。此外,签名也是确认交易所有权的重要工具。只有拥有对应私钥的用户才能发起支出,从而确保比特币的去中心化特性得以维持。
丢失比特币钱包的私钥几乎意味着失去对钱包中比特币的控制权。因为没有私钥,用户无法生成新的签名,也就无法进行任何交易。虽然已经签名的交易依然有效,但一旦私钥丢失,用户将无法发起新的交易,因此务必妥善保管私钥。
公钥与签名是两个不同的概念。公钥是从私钥生成的,用户可以通过公钥接收比特币。然而,签名是根据交易的具体内容和私钥生成的,公钥不能直接获得签名。虽然交易信息和签名会在区块链上记录,但解读这些信息需要特定的工具和知识。
综合签名是指一个钱包生成的单一签名,而多重签名则需要多个私钥签名才能完成特定的交易。这意味着只有在获得多个用户确认后,交易才能被执行。多重签名进一步增强了交易的安全性,适用于需要更高安全级别的场合,例如企业资金管理。
由于比特币的签名机制基于安全复杂的数学算法,目前没有已知的方法能够有效破解签名。然而,随着计算能力的飞速发展,理论上存在被破解的风险。因此,保管私钥的安全措施如冷存储和多重签名等变得愈加重要。
用户通常可以在比特币钱包应用中查看交易记录,包括签名信息。但由于签名是加密后的,它不会以易读的形式显示。在区块链浏览器中,用户可以通过输入交易哈希查询到相应的交易信息,包括签名和其他交易详情。确保使用信誉良好的区块链浏览器进行查询。
综上所述,比特币钱包的签名是保障交易安全的重要组成部分。理解其生成过程及作用,可以帮助用户更好地管理和保护他们的数字资产。在日益增长的数字货币环境中,安全意识显得尤为重要。希望本文能够帮助用户更深入地了解比特币钱包签名及其在交易中的重要作用。